The proliferation of big data has revolutionized numerous sectors, and online learning curricula are no exception. Educators increasingly leverage the power of data to develop more effective and engaging learning experiences. Through the analysis of student performance data, engagement metrics, and feedback insights, instructors can identify areas where students struggle and tailor their curricula accordingly.

Data-driven design allows for real-time adjustments to content, pacing, and instructional strategies. By monitoring student progress, educators can offer targeted support and interventions, ensuring that all learners thrive. Moreover, data analytics can help the identification of effective pedagogical practices, enabling instructors to enhance their teaching methods.

  • Furthermore, big data can be used to tailor learning pathways based on individual student needs and preferences.
  • These level of customization allows for a more impactful learning experience, as students are challenged at their own pace and in a way that makes sense to them.

The Algorithmic Curriculum: Exploring the Role of Big Data in Course Design

In a rapidly evolving educational landscape, institutions are increasingly turning to big data to optimize course design. A burgeoning field known as the algorithmic curriculum explores the potential of big data insights to tailor learning experiences and elevate student outcomes.

By collecting vast amounts of student performance data, models can identify patterns of learning behavior, anticipating areas where students may struggle. Such insights could be used to design more relevant curricula, providing tailored learning pathways that cater the unique needs of each student.

  • Furthermore, algorithmic curriculum design can simplify logistical tasks, providing space for educators to concentrate on student interaction.
  • However, there are too ethical considerations that need to be addressed carefully.

With example, questions regarding data privacy, algorithm bias, and the possibility of over-reliance on technology must be meticulously considered. Ultimately, the successful integration of algorithmic curriculum design requires a balanced approach that values both advancement and responsible practices.
